On May 7, the O Mon District Labor Federation (LDLD) held a groundbreaking ceremony for the construction of a Union Shelter for 3 union members with difficult housing circumstances in the district. Vice President of Can Tho City Labor Federation Doan Van Dung attended.

The union members who started the shelter were Tran Thi Ut hot (Thoi Long Secondary School Trade Union), Ngo Thi Ut Nhi (sen Hong Kindergarten Trade Union) and Huynh Trong Nghia (O Mon District Culture, Sports and Tourism and Information Technology Trade Union).
It is known that, before the commencement of the union, the houses of the union members were seriously degraded, the structure was not guaranteed but did not have the conditions to repair. Realizing the difficulties of union members, the City Labor Union, the District Labor Confederation and the grassroots grassroots Union have promptly implemented supporting union members to build trade unions.

At the ceremony, each union member received support of 50 million VND to build a Union Shelter from the Golden Heart Social Charity Fund Branch in Can Tho.
